
BPL’s service basket already provides Voice SMS to its customers. The company has taken a step ahead by launching the same service on an international scale. This service includes Voice Messages being sent by BPL users all across the world, whatever the time zone may be. The company will be partnering with Kirusa, which has its headquarters in New Jersey and is the leading Voice Service provider in the world.
Just to give you’ll a description of the service, the Indian customer would dial *00, followed by the international number and then record the message. To send the message, all that the user has to do is hang up and the receiver will receive the message as audio. As for the charges, they will be out soon. But BPL has, with this launch, announced that current BPL users can avail of unlimited Voice Messaging service nationally for a charge of Rs.50 per month.
